**Q: What happens when Mailcull marks a bounce as permanent?**

Mailcull, our email bounce processor, classifies hard bounces after three consecutive failures and suppresses the address automatically. Soft bounces are retried for 72 hours. If the suppression list itself becomes corrupted, restore it from the encrypted nightly snapshot in the Thornfield backup bucket. Restoring requires the team recovery passphrase, which is kept directly below this entry for emergencies.

unlock words, kahof-bahap: praax-ulaix

Team,

Our analysis shows Torvane Industrial now accounts for 41% of recurring revenue across the Marlet product family, up from 28% a year ago. While the relationship is healthy, any renegotiation or downturn on their side would materially affect our forecasts. Sales leads should begin mapping mid-market prospects in adjacent verticals and report pipeline additions by month-end. Please treat the figures above as internal only. The confidential direction from the executive committee follows below.

confidential, kagep-kahof: Druokax Systems plans to lower the Ulaath list price by 53 percent in March.

Ticket: Config drift on reminder job (Willowmere Clinic Scheduler)

Hey on-call — the appointment reminder job in prod has drifted from what's in the repo again. Someone hot-patched the send window last month and it never got committed, so patients in the western region are getting reminders at odd hours. Please reconcile the live values against source and redeploy. For reference, here's what the job is actually running with right now.

settings of kagap-fajep:
[zorys]
team = ulavan
access_code = ac_08fa8f
host = zorys.kelvinet.corp
port = 3000
owner = wenix.weneth
peer = wenath.brasksys.test

## Ownership

The clock-skew monitor for the Quarrylight build farm lives in this repo. Build agents occasionally drift more than the 250ms tolerance, which breaks artifact timestamp ordering and causes the Slatebird scheduler to mark runs as flaky. If support sees skew alerts, first check the NTP sidecar logs, then escalate rather than restarting agents manually — restarts mask the drift without fixing it. Questions about the monitor, its thresholds, or the escalation path go to the component owner listed below.

account owner for kagag-yahap: Novath Quenok